Country super star and legend Glen Campbell drew a sell-out crowd at Diamondjacks Casino and Resort in Bossier City Saturday night. There wasn't a seat left in the house as fans were clamoring to hear Campbell croon and play the guitar on what is his "The Goodbye Tour."

Campbell has been touring with three of his children in his band since 2010. And they were as outstanding as their father.  Ashley was on keyboard, banjo and vocals.  During one song,  she played the banjo and keyboard at the same time.

Then there was  Shannon with the crazy punk rock hair and amazing voice and guitar playing.  In fact,  he played an instrumental part with his dad on "Galveston." '   Both father and son picking like nobody's business.

Then on the drums, was his son, Cal.   Glen was wonderful, with a smooth mature voice bringing out what a record can't do - his charm. His guitar picking was also as good as ever.

Campbell has been suffering from Alzheimer's since June of 2010, and there were a few moments when he forgot lyrics or notes, but daughter Ashely was right there to help him get it back.
